Subject: Quickstore 4.2 — bloom filter now fronts the KV layer

Plugin authors: starting with this release, Quickstore places a bloom filter ahead of the key-value store. Negative lookups return faster; false positives fall through safely. No API changes are required on your side. Verify your plugin against the staging build referenced below.

session token of fahif-tadup = htk3_9c7

## Service accounts — Echodocent audio-guide app

Three service accounts exist: playback-sync, exhibit-metadata, and analytics-relay. Each scoped minimally; no shared credentials. Rotation is quarterly, owned by the platform rota. The analytics-relay account was recreated last week after scope creep was flagged at sync. Staging uses separate accounts — never reuse prod credentials there. The current exhibit-metadata service key is below.

service key, fafop-kaguf: vxb7-m3DSNYe

**Subject: DR drill — consent banner rollout systems**

Hello new team members. Next Thursday we run the quarterly disaster-recovery drill for the Fenwicker consent banner service. During the drill, the banner config store in the Ashdell region will be deliberately taken offline, and you will practice restoring it from the warm standby. Please read the rollout checklist beforehand and attend the briefing. To unlock the drill restore bundle, use the recovery passphrase shown below.

strongbox words: jorir-eliiel-gilys-zorys-eliir-aldion-aldvan-pelmir-silax-rusdor-istix-noviel-frair-tamion

## Ticket: Config drift caused stale-cache regression

Following the Mothwing stale-cache postmortem, we found the cache TTL and invalidation-fanout settings on two production nodes diverged from the canonical values after a manual hotfix was never backported. This is why invalidations appeared to work in staging but not in production. Please reconcile all nodes against the source-of-truth values and add a drift check to the deploy pipeline. The canonical cache settings are reproduced below.

deployment values, kagef-hahap:
wenael:
  log_level: warn
  metrics_host: metrics.wenael.qorvelsys.internal
  pin: 3768
  pool_size: 32